Holy moly I just had the best smoked salmon eggs Benedict ever. Excellent fresh and healthy ingredients cooked perfectly. The drip coffee from Fernwood, a local rostery, was divine too, with smooth, bright fruity note without the over powering acidity. Wonderful staff too. Free parking at the side lot.

I have been to HOB and long table events many times. I
Think it is amazing to have a restaurant of this calibre in our neighborhood. However my last two experiences have been very disappointing. In June my friends and I went to girls night. No complaints at all about the food that night but the service was really poor. The hostess was very nice but our waitress (short young women with long black hair) was terrible. It was not busy but it took her forever to acknowledge us. She dropped the plates at the table without a word. No explanation of the items nothing. She never came to top up our wine or water! I put it down to a bad night! Then 2 weeks ago I brought some friends from out of town for dinner on a Thursday night. It was not busy but again same waitress was assigned to our table. This woman does not belong serving people. It took her forever to acknowledge us we had a few questions about the menu items and I don’t think she could have provided less information or enthusiasm if she tried. She did not top up wine or water. Again dropped off the dishes and when I asked what something was on my plate she said “mash” Normally when I go to a restaurant like this the waiter will explain what is on the plate. The gentleman who delivered on of the dishes certainly did so. The food was not as good as usual. The salmon was supposed to be 6 oz but sure didn’t seem to be. The duck wings were not good. Like chewing elastic. My mushroom risotto was really good. I was really disappointed and a bit embarrassed after Bragg up this place for so long. I think I will give it a rest before returning and if I find I am going to be served by the same waitress I won’t stay.

Went for the weekly ladies night menu specifically, because HOB has such high ratings and it seemed like a good deal. I traveled all the way from downtown Victoria. The food was alright, but the service was some of the slowest I've ever experienced. The restuarant was at less than half capacity and it was a weekday evening. It took over an hour to get our drinks, the very first thing we ordered. We only got them after asking the waitress what was taking so long - the worst part was after all that waiting, the cocktail was terrible. I am not picky about my drinks, and if I paid for booze I won't waste it - but this one was undrinkable. It tasted like mustard mixed with fruit juice (the menu did mention mustard in the drink but Id hoped it would be well balanced). We didn't even get water served to us for over half an hour, with the menus. The menus didn't include the ladies night special they were advertising, so I asked what was included and the waitress was unsure. It took another 20 minutes to get the ladies night menu. When dinner finally arrived it looked nice but the piece of salmon was so small. All in all, it was a 2.5 hour affair and a disappointment. The only consolation was getting to spend extra time chatting with my friend between every course, and dessert was tasty - but I took it home because I was tired of being there!
